EKSPLORASI MIKROBA EPIFIT, ENDOFIT DAN RIZOSFER DARI BERBAGAI SUMBER PADI GOGO DI KECAMATAN KULAWI KABUPATEN SIGI
Exploration carried out in the filosphere area (leaves) and rhizosphere area (roots) in upland rice plants to get the type of microbes that have potential that can be utilized as biological fertilizer sources, such as N2 fastening microbes, plant growth microbes or phosphate solvent microbial as well as those acting as natural enemies. The research was conducted by location survey method. Determination of location is done by purposive sampling, which is the location of upland rice cultivated by farmers in Kulawi District. The results showed that 10 isolates were isolated from epiphytic and endophytic microbes and endophytes. Morphological tests showed differences in color, shape, elevation, edge, texture and size and the coloring test showed that the bacteria had Coccus cell forms, Bacill, Diplococcus and Semi-Bacillus.
